Biography

I'm a Professor of the School of Information and Artificial Intelligence at Anhui Agricultural University. I got my Ph.D. in the Department of Computer Science and Technology at Hefei University of Technology in 2022, coadvised by Prof. Hao Wang and Prof. Kui Yu.

Research Interests

My research interests include machine learning, artificial intelligence, and data mining. In particular, I am interested in causal inference, stable learning, transfer learning, bioinformatics, and smart agriculture.
